Procedural Posture

Environment and Land Case / Ruling on Preliminary Objection

  1. 1 Whether the suit is sub judice in light of a previously instituted suit involving the same parties and subject matter.
  2. 2 Whether the plaintiff's claim is time barred under the Limitation of Actions Act.
  3. 3 Whether the court has jurisdiction to entertain the suit given the preliminary objections raised.

Ratio Decidendi

The court found that the present suit was sub judice as there was a previously instituted suit in Sotik PMC ELC No E040 of 2021 involving the same parties and subject matter, and no evidence was provided by the plaintiff to show that the earlier suit had been terminated. Additionally, the court held that the plaintiff's claim was time barred under Section 7 of the Limitation of Actions Act, as the cause of action arose in 1995 and the suit was filed 27 years later, well beyond the 12-year limitation period for recovery of land.
